This book is designed to assist both amateur and professional algologists with the identification of the commoner freshwater algae and to bridge a gap between the shorter guides and the expensive reference works, many of which are in foreign languages or out of print.

People have been fascinated by freshwater algae since the first good microscopes became available in the early eighteen century but the first British book on the subject was Dillwyn's British Confervae published in 1809.
